Overview

The nVent CCFO816 Modular Inverted Cable Entry System is a black polyamide cable entry solution with NBR/EPDM seals, measuring 64x126x24mm. Designed for external snap-in mounting on enclosures with 1.4–2mm wall thickness, it enables all cable routing, sealing, and strain relief operations from outside the enclosure. This inverted design simplifies installation and maintenance in confined spaces or pre-populated cabinets, reducing downtime and labor costs. The system supports both pre-assembled and unassembled cables, with or without connectors, offering versatile compatibility for control cabinets, automation systems, and power distribution units. Its modular construction allows customization to specific project requirements, while the IP65 rating ensures reliable protection against dust and water ingress when properly installed. The flame-retardant V-0 rated housing operates reliably from -30°C to +90°C, making it suitable for harsh industrial environments. Key specifications include a 64x126x24mm footprint, external snap-in mounting, and compatibility with nVent’s cable management ecosystem. How to Install the CCFO816 Cable Entry System

This guide provides step-by-step instructions for installing the CCFO816 cable entry system, ensuring proper mounting and sealing of cables.

Estimated time: 45m

Tools needed:

Screwdriver, Torque wrench

Supplies needed:

M5 stainless steel screws, Cable seals, Washers, Nuts

  1. Prepare the installation area

    Ensure the installation area is clean and free of debris. Verify that the enclosure is suitable for the CCFO816 dimensions.

  2. Mount the cable entry system

    Align the CCFO816 with the cutout in the enclosure. Secure it using four M5 stainless steel screws, ensuring to account for the 3mm thickness of the gland plate.

  3. Seal the cables

    Guide the cables through the frame and attach the seals to each cable. Ensure that the seals are pushed all the way in to prevent ingress.

  4. Assemble the hood

    Insert washers and nuts into the hood assembly. Tighten the nuts from the inside to a torque of 3 Nm (26 in-lbs) to secure the hood.

  5. Finalize the installation

    Click the inlays into position and snap the hood onto the frame. If applicable, remove the optional locking bars and snap them into position.

What is nVent's warranty policy?

nVent offers a standard 18-month warranty from invoicing date for most automation products, covering defects in workmanship and materials. The warranty requires proper transportation, handling, storage, and installation within specified environmental conditions. Warranty coverage includes repair or replacement at nVent's discretion, with certain conditions such as authorized service repairs and operation within designed capacity limits.
